Dental Outreach for Migrant Farm Workers in Oklahoma

In Oklahoma, the unique demographic of migrant farm workers poses distinct challenges regarding access to dental care. This population, which often moves seasonally for agricultural work, faces multiple barriers, including language disparities, lack of transportation, and inadequate insurance coverage. According to a recent survey, over 43% of migrant farm workers in Oklahoma reported having no regular dental care provider, highlighting a significant gap in access to basic oral health services. With many of these individuals working in labor-intensive conditions, the implications of untreated dental issues can severely affect their overall health and employment stability.

The primary recipients of funding under this grant will be organizations capable of providing mobile dental clinics targeted at this transient population. The migrant worker community in Oklahoma often includes families with children, for whom access to preventive care is particularly important. Many workers face stressful living conditions and are unable to seek care during their limited time off, illustrating the urgent need for targeted interventions that meet them where they live and work.

Eligible applicants must demonstrate the capacity to mobilize dental outreach services effectively tailored to the needs of migrant farm workers. This involves developing comprehensive outreach strategies that educate this population on available dental services, meanwhile delivering preventive care directly in farming communities. The program seeks to mitigate barriers by not only providing services but also addressing cultural and linguistic challenges that could hinder individuals from seeking care.

With a focus on sustainability, this initiative also aims to engage community partners to foster a holistic approach to oral health for migrant farm workers. It offers the potential of establishing ongoing relationships with local health organizations and agricultural employers, creating pathways for continuous access to dental care even after the initial outreach efforts conclude. By ensuring that migrant farm workers receive adequate preventive care, Oklahoma can work towards reducing long-term health disparities faced by this vulnerable population.

In conclusion, this funding initiative aims to address the specific and complex barriers faced by migrant farm workers in Oklahoma. By delivering necessary dental services directly to this transient community, the program seeks to foster better oral health outcomes, ultimately benefiting the workers and their families while promoting a healthier workforce.
